    My DS who is 2.5yr old has never been a good sleeper and we have finally got him out of our bed onto the floor on a mattrass next to my DH. Even that was a struggle but we finally got there. He has always hated his room, big bed and cot and since he was a tiny bub he has never been one to sleep through the night or put himself to sleep. We even got to the stage about 8 weeks before my DS#2 was born, we paid a sleep nurse to come and show us how to get him to sleep in his big bed and how we needed to do it. It was exactly what we had been doing, persisting (I hate that word)

    He slept with us throughout my whole pregnancy and to be honest, we were and are completely over him sleeping with us. We now have our bed back but just not our room - so no sneaky business for us... LOL

    All I can say is do what works for you... I definitely think you should try moving his sister into his room. Is she a good sleeper - he might end up climbing out of his cot and sleeping with her...LOL
